We work in partnership Good Shepherd to provide free assistance to vulnerable community members securing urgent financial needs.


By connecting individuals with the appropriate resources, we enable them to receive right support through no-interest loans.

Computer & Smartphone Workshops

The session covered issues around security when using mobile phones, email, non-cash payments and identifying fake identities on social networks. AVAC also brought energy to the program with vibrant singing and dancing performances. This initiative is part of AVAC's broader efforts to support seniors' physical and mental well-being.
